Output 874cbfa77a62307938c9bf1d160cba954e748aaa4bf2e9bcb66a2ca102f07389:0

value
134386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5bf6049aacc4fbd6075d1db3e8f677f1cd4813 OP_EQUAL
address
3BfFk1tRv467VhbfNSC5YLvfEuVQaFzvRK
transaction
874cbfa77a62307938c9bf1d160cba954e748aaa4bf2e9bcb66a2ca102f07389